About Owen Park in Tulsa

Owen Park is a historic neighborhood and municipal park located in Tulsa, Oklahoma. Established on June 8, 1910, it holds the distinction of being Tulsa's first public park. The park covers approximately 24 acres on the eastern side of the Owen Park Historic District, which spans 163.48 acres in total.

The park's history dates back to the early 20th century when it was part of land owned by Chauncey Owen. In 1909, the city purchased over 20 acres from Owen and his wife Mary for $13,500 to create the park. Initially, there was criticism about the land's price and its distance from downtown, but the announcement of a streetcar line to the park helped alleviate concerns.

Owen Park features a small lake created in 1913 when a ravine was dammed. This lake served as a popular swimming spot through the 1920s, complete with a twelve-foot diving tower. While swimming is no longer permitted, the lake remains a focal point of the park and is home to ducks and geese.

The park has witnessed several historical events and changes over the years. In 1910, five acres were sold to the Tulsa Vitrified Brick Company, leading to the creation of a large pit. After a tragic drowning incident in 1954, the city repurchased and filled the pit, reincorporating the land into the park.

Owen Park is not just a recreational space but also a site of historical significance. It houses monuments commemorating the meeting point of Cherokee, Creek, and Osage Indian nations, as well as a memorial to author Washington Irving, who wrote about the views from the park's hilltop.
